首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Pandas:带有重复索引的concat

Pandas是一个开源的数据分析和数据操作工具包,提供了丰富的数据结构和数据处理功能。其中,concat函数是Pandas中的一个函数,用于将多个数据结构进行拼接。

在使用concat函数时,如果数据结构中存在重复索引,concat函数会保留这些重复索引。具体来说,concat函数会将多个数据结构按照指定的轴进行拼接,并保留所有的索引。

concat函数的主要参数如下:

  • objs:需要进行拼接的数据结构,可以是Series、DataFrame或者Panel对象的序列(例如列表或元组)。
  • axis:指定拼接的轴,0表示按行拼接,1表示按列拼接。
  • join:指定拼接的方式,可选的取值有inner和outer。inner表示取交集,即只保留重复索引的部分;outer表示取并集,即保留所有索引。
  • ignore_index:指定是否忽略拼接后的索引,如果设为True,则将生成新的索引。

concat函数的优势是能够快速方便地将多个数据结构进行拼接,特别是在处理大规模数据时非常高效。

在实际应用中,concat函数可以用于以下场景:

  • 合并来自不同源的数据,比如多个文件中的数据。
  • 将数据按照某个轴进行扩展,以生成更大的数据集。
  • 在数据分析和数据处理中,将多个数据结构进行合并,以方便后续的统计和计算。

对于腾讯云的相关产品和产品介绍链接地址,可以参考腾讯云官方文档或者咨询腾讯云官方客服获取更详细的信息。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的合辑

领券